Key Pedagogical Outcomes
·
Dismountable
Movable Left Section: Allows students to
simulate slip-strike and dip-slip faulting, supporting "Tectonic Mechanism
Analysis."
·
Removable
Upper Tectonic Plate: Facilitates the
visualization of subsurface strata vs. surface geomorphology, supporting
"Subsurface Mapping and Geodesy."
·
Anticlinal
Valley and Synclinal Mountain Indicators: Enables the analysis of differential erosion on folded
structures, supporting "Structural Geomorphology."
·
Integrated
Internal Stratigraphy:
Connects mechanical deformation to the displacement of sedimentary layers,
reinforcing "Lithological Correlation" curricula.
